ORDER
This petition has been filed to direct the 3rd respondent not to harass the petitioner insisting the petitioner too handover the above property to the extent of 32 cents in Survey No.641/1G at Perunkudi Part-1 Village, Radhapuram Taluk, Tiruenelveli District that too while the suit in O.S.No. 197 of 2016 is pending on the file of the learned Principal District Munsif Court, Valliyoor, Tirunelveli District.

2.Heard the learned counsel for the petitioner and the learned Government Advocate (Crl. Side) for the respondents. 3.Today, Mr.K.Sheik Syed Karim, Panagudi Police Station, Tirunelveli District is present before this Court. 4.When the matter was taken up for hearing, the learned Government Advocate submitted that civil suits are pending between the parties. It is further submitted that on the complaint given by one Innocent Rakini, sister-in-law of the petitioner, a petition enquiry was conducted and both parties have been advised to settle their disputes through the civil Court.
5. Recording the said submission, this petition is closed with a direction to the respondent police not to interfere in the civil dispute between the parties unless, there is a commission of cognizable offences.
